A historic marker tells of the 1909 lynching of Richard Robertson, Nov. 20, 2022, in Mobile, Alabama. Robertson, a local carpenter, was accused of assault and the killing of a white deputy. A mob of 30 abducted Robertson from the Mobile County Jail and lynched him within sight of the jail. No one was prosecuted for Robertson’s death. (Photo by Carmen K. Sisson/Cloudybright)
